4.Thelanguagefeatureofheadlines
Aheadlineisaimingatsummarizingawholearticlewithafewwords.Sojournalistsmakegreateffortinchoosingtherightwordswhichareclearinmeaningandeconomyinspace.
Therearesomepreferenceforjournalistsandeditors
First,theyuseabundantofsimplewords.Someareteenytinylittlewordsthatlivelyexpresssomemeaning.“Hit”or“ruin”areoftenusedinsteadof“damage”
Second,initialsareoftenusedtosavespace,like“WTO”or“ABM”
Thirdly,Abbreviationsareused,whichcanbeeasilyrecognizedbyreaders.Suchas“ad”and”biz”whichcanbeeasilyfoundintheEnglishnewspaper.
Fourthly,thereisflexibleuseofjournalisticcoinages.Tosavetimeandspace,journalistsoftencombinetwoormorewordsintoonewordinpracticeandcoinagethencomesintobeing.Theyareveryimpressiveandcatchy,someevenhavethecharacteristicoforiginality,like“newscast.”

7.DifferencebetweenChineseheadlineandEnglishhead?
Theyaredifferentinfourways.
First,ChineseheadlinesusuallyprovidemoreinformationthanEnglishheads.Chineseheadsareoftenmulti-deck,andEnglishheadsareoftenone-deck,thusChineseheadlinestendtofocusonthetotalityofthenews.Andifitcannotincludeallthefactsthatisneededinthehead,thesubheadcandothejob.AnotherreasonitusuallycarriesmoreinfoisthateachChinesecharactertakesupequalspace,whileEnglishwordsarenot.Asaresult,Chineseheadstendtobelikemini-storyincapsuleform,whileEnglishheadsaccentuateononeimportantfactorofthenews.Theseconddifferenceisthedifferenceintheuseofwords.LikeinEnglishheads,it’sano-notobeginaheadwithaverb.ButinChineseheadlines,it’sok.ThereareabundantuseofsimplewordswhichservetosavespaceinEnglishheads,butyoucanneednottofollowthatruleforeveryChinesecharactertakesupequalspace.Foranotherexample,peopleseldomuseadjectivesoradverbsinEnglishheadsfollowingtheprincipleof“ABC”(accuracy,brevityandclarity),butyoucaneasilygraspapieceofChinesenewswithadjectivesoradverbsintheheadline.Thirdly,theyaredifferentintense.Englishheadsoftenusepresenttensewhichhadbeencalled“historicalpresenttense”topresentyesterday’snews,andavoidtime-indicatingwordslike“yesterday’or“lastnight”.ButChineseheadsuse
themtoindicatethehappeningtime.
Thelastdifferenceshouldbeinthewordlayout.YoucanneverlaytheEnglishheadlinesinverticalform,butyoucancertainlydothatinChineseheads.PeopleusesinglequotationmarkinEnglishheadlinesbutdoublequotationmarkinChineseheadline.

11.Newsstructure
Invertedpyramidstyle:
itisthemostfrequentlyusedstructureinnewswriting.Inthisstructure,eventsarewrittenindescendingorderofimportance.Firstofall,aterseleadisformed.Theleadoffersthemostessentialelementstellingwho,what,when,where,whyandhowofthestory.
Advantages:
First,itisconvenientforeditorstodecidethenewsvalueandcutthenewsfromthebottom;
Second,itisconvenientforjournaliststomeetthedeadlinewithoutmissinganykeyfacts;
Third,itcanhelpreaderstofindthemainfactsofthenewsquickly.
Disadvantages:
First,themainfactsallfrequentlyappearintheheadline,leadandbody,whichwouldbesuffocativetomostreaders;
Second,thewritingisnottightlyorganizedandfullydeployed,what’smore,thestyleistopheavyandlackofsuspenseinterest.
Pyramidstyle/thechronologicalstyle
Itiscomposedbythreeparts,theyarebeginning,bodyandending.Towriteapieceofnewsinpyramidstyle,abeginningisgivenfirstandeventsarewrittenin
timesequence.Writerscantakeadvantageofnarrativeanddescriptivewriting,soitflowsbetterandinvolvesreaders.Atthemeantime,itaddssuspenseinteresttothestory.
Mixedformofinventedpyramidandpyramidstyle(Circlestyle)
Afteralead,eventsarewrittenintimesequence.Ithastheadvantagesofpyramidstyleandimportantfactscanbepresentedhighinthestory.Themostimportantinformationisrepeatedinthenarrative,sothatreaderscanhaveachancetoabsorbit.Itismoreeffectivestorytellingandcankeepreadersinteresteduntiltheendthenleadsuptoarealconclusion.Comparingwiththeotherstyles,thisformismorebalanced.Butitdiscourageseditorsslashthestoryfromthebottom.Listtechnique
